Skip to:
Content
Pages
Categories
Search
Top
Bottom

[Resolved] a way to add a list of 168 city to profile fields automatically?


  • Walid
    Participant

    @walid3

    hello, I added the states of my country manually in a “drop down select box” profile field, they were 27, now I want to add the cities, I could of course leave that for members to write, but I wanted it to be written in the same way and language for every user to have better search, so is there any way to copy the list of cities each in a line and it can added as profile field somehow? is there a plugin or some way to do that? this can come in handy at adding many others lists like colleges or universities in the whole country with just the list of their names.

Viewing 11 replies - 1 through 11 (of 11 total)

  • bp-help
    Participant

    @bphelp

    @walid3
    It would be helpful to have a list of those 168 cities in your country, preferably as a text document that could easily be pasted into some code.


    aces
    Participant

    @aces

    Maybe the technique used here for US States could be adapted for your cities: https://gist.github.com/modemlooper/5170950 ?

    For a similar way of adding Countries see https://gist.github.com/modemlooper/5043768


    bp-help
    Participant

    @bphelp

    @walid3 @aces
    I was thinking of suggesting something along the same lines and just adapt it for cities
    same author @modemlooper .
    Seems like this would be simpler to me anyway:
    https://gist.github.com/modemlooper/5043768


    Walid
    Participant

    @walid3

    Thank you so much guys but I think it will still be time consuming to add each mark before and after every city name ( or is there a way to add them automatically too? )

    I think adding a feature like that to buddypress core would be fantastic, like an option to add a list of names instead of one by one.


    bp-help
    Participant

    @bphelp

    @walid3
    If you can supply a link with a list to your countries cities then I will try to help you out.


    Walid
    Participant

    @walid3

    I would be thankful for that, here is the list of cities I need to add at the moment:
    http://pastebin.com/pWayVDQH


    bp-help
    Participant

    @bphelp

    @walid3
    Not sure about the translation but add the code in the link below to bp-custom.php
    http://pastebin.com/asjAAcru


    Walid
    Participant

    @walid3

    Thanks so much for your help 🙂 also, I think about suggesting this as a feature in buddypress trac if that is available, it will be so much better adding all those kind of lists fields through admin panel. I will add the cities list for now, thank you again 🙂


    bp-help
    Participant

    @bphelp

    @walid3
    Glad I could help but realistically that would take a huge amount of effort for the BP Dev team to integrate every country, every state, and every city in the world into BP so I don’t think they would look too seriously at something of this nature. But then again that is just my opinion.


    Walid
    Participant

    @walid3

    No, sure I didn’t mean inserting countries or cities, I was talking about adding a field in profile fields that open a box where you can paste a list of names and it populate as drop down select box, can come in handy adding every kind of lists.


    bp-help
    Participant

    @bphelp

    @walid3
    That sounds like a great idea that maybe you should open a ticket on this.

Viewing 11 replies - 1 through 11 (of 11 total)
  • The topic ‘[Resolved] a way to add a list of 168 city to profile fields automatically?’ is closed to new replies.
Skip to toolbar